The image depicts three figures in a seated position. There is a woman holding a child on her lap, and an older man sitting behind them. The woman is turned slightly towards the child, lifting a piece of drapery with one hand while supporting the child with the other. She has styled, wavy hair and is dressed in flowing robes. The child appears to be a baby with curly hair. The older man has a long beard and is looking towards the child with an intent expression. The background is plain with subtle rocky surface details, and there is a halo-like circle around the woman's head. The number "1597" is inscribed in the bottom left corner of the image.
